First report from the Royal Cork Yacht Club team sailing in the Dennis Conner International Yacht Club Invitational.
On Day One of the event August 15th, Sinéad Enright reports the team sailed three windward/leeward races all with a leeward leg to start. Conditions were very tricky with shifty winds and strong currents and also a very large amount of commercial traffic to avoid. RCYC had a 7th out of 20 finish for this race. In Race 2 the team were in second place but lost out at the mark and could not recover in time to get a finish. In the final race of the day, Race 3, the team posted a 5th place.
